Another thread got me to thinking. It was asked why no one had prophesied of World War I, II, other conflicts, etc.

The greatest prophesy of the Old Testament prophets was the coming of Jesus Christ.

Other than that what other prophesies that were made by Old Testament or New Testament prophets have come to past or are we still waiting for?

We are looking for specific not vague prophesies. Ones that can be said "Ah yes that is what was prophesied".

I had to look this up because I remembered this from years past.

But one I remember Neal A. Maxwell talking about is Luke 21:25. The perplexity of nations.

Here is his quote I found:

Our time already reflects yet another prophecy: “Distress of nations, with perplexity” (Luke 21:25). Before modern times, global perplexity simply was not possible. Now, there is a quick transmission of some crises and problems from one nation to others—the consequences of debt-ridden economies, the spreading of diseases, the abuse of narcotics, and, perhaps most of all, a shared sense of near-helplessness in the face of such perplexities. Today, the assembled agonies of the world pass in reminding review on the nightly news.

I believe that one of the most precise and exact prophecies of the Old Testament concerns the restoration or establishment of G-d’s kingdom in the Last Days. In Chapter two of Daniel the Kingdoms of the earth are given in prophesy. The final kingdom is of part Iron and clay. This is understood to be the Roman Empire. Daniel prophesies that this empire will be divided into 10 kingdoms at some point of time – represented by the ten toes of the figure. In verse 44 Daniel tells us that in the days of these kings (10 in number) the kingdom of G-d will be established. When the kingdom of G-d is established as a small stone (which will not ever be overthrown) that will become large to cover the earth the contrast is that the ten kingdoms will fall and never again be established. I would point out that WWII was an effort to establish the 3rd Reich which was the 3rd Holy Roman Empire – that never took place.

There was only one time that the Roman Empire was divided into exactly 10 kingdoms with 10 kings and that points us to the year 1830. Since 1830 all ten kingdoms have fallen and to this day none are governed by kings but rather are governed by democracies.
